Marketing Mix
A combination of factors that can be controlled by a company to influence consumers to purchase its products, typically summarized as product, price, place, and promotion.
Four Ps
Refers to Product, Price, Place, and Promotion; key marketing mix elements used to position a business strategically in its market.
Marketing Activities
Efforts and strategies employed by companies to promote, sell, and distribute their products or services.
